However, several states, including Washington, asserted that they were not subject to such lawsuits because of the State’s sovereign immunity. IGRA requires states to negotiate in good faith with tribes regarding any form of gaming that is authorized in the state for any person or purpose. The Indian Gaming Regulatory Act (IGRA), passed by Congress in 1988, permits tribes to conduct certain types of gaming (Class III) only if they enter into a compact with the state. Where a machine offers taxable ‘relevant machine games’ and other games or activities that are not taxable, the payments received should be directly attributed to each activity. Mixed machine games offer players the opportunity to win cash and non-cash prizes. As of 27 April 2009 all bingo participation fees and session charges became exempt from VAT. Participation and session charges are made for the right to take part in a game or series of games of bingo. If a retailer sells lottery tickets as an agent for either a lottery management company or promoter, the commission that they receive is a consideration for the exempt service of selling lottery tickets to the public.
